The Mods Folder
To get started with mods, you’ll need to create a "Mods" folder in the .minecraft directory of your Minecraft installation. The .minecraft folder is usually located in the following path:
- Windows:
C:UsersYourUsernameAppDataRoaming.minecraft - Mac:
~/Library/Application Support/minecraft
Create a new folder named "Mods" in this directory and extract your mods (.jar files) into this folder.

Troubleshooting Common Issues
If you encounter issues with your mods, check the following:
- Mod compatibility: Ensure that the mods you’re using are compatible with each other and with the base game.
- Mod version: Make sure you’re using the correct version of the mod for your Minecraft version.
- Conflicting mods: If you’re using multiple mods that modify the same game mechanics, you may experience conflicts.
